GERMAN DUMPLINGS - "SEMMELKNODEL" Recipe

Ingredients:  
Ingredients:  
Bowl of hard rolls or bread, sliced - let sit out 2 days to get stale
1-1/2 c. heated milk
2 eggs
1/2 c. parsley chopped
1 large onion, chopped
Salt
Butter

Directions:
Directions:
Slice bread and let it sit out for 2-3 days.
Pour milk over bread and let it soak in until soft.
Sauté onions & parsley. Mix with the bread.
Add eggs and flour. Roll into balls the size of a baseball - using wet hands.

In a large saucepan, bring salted water to a boil.

To test to see if the dumplings will hold together - do a trial run.
Add dumpling to the water to cook. If it stays together, you can go ahead and boil remaining dumplings you make in the large saucepan. If it's too soft - add flour.

Bring to a rolling boil and simmer 25 minutes. Serve with anything having gravy.
